Subject: [PATCH 19/26] scsi: separate out scsi_(host|driver)byte_string()
Date: Tue, 7 Oct 2014 11:03:18 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1412672605-42868-20-git-send-email-hare@suse.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1412672605-42868-1-git-send-email-hare@suse.de>
Export functions for later use.
Reviewed-by: Robert Elliott <elliott@hp.com>
Reviewed-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
Signed-off-by: Hannes Reinecke <hare@suse.de>
---
drivers/scsi/constants.c | 58 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------
include/scsi/scsi_dbg.h | 2 ++
2 files changed, 46 insertions(+), 14 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/scsi/constants.c b/drivers/scsi/constants.c
index ea391f8..0fe50b4 100644
--- a/drivers/scsi/constants.c
+++ b/drivers/scsi/constants.c
@@ -1406,38 +1406,68 @@ static const char * const hostbyte_table[]={
"DID_PASSTHROUGH", "DID_SOFT_ERROR", "DID_IMM_RETRY", "DID_REQUEUE",
"DID_TRANSPORT_DISRUPTED", "DID_TRANSPORT_FAILFAST", "DID_TARGET_FAILURE",
"DID_NEXUS_FAILURE" };
-#define NUM_HOSTBYTE_STRS ARRAY_SIZE(hostbyte_table)
static const char * const driverbyte_table[]={
"DRIVER_OK", "DRIVER_BUSY", "DRIVER_SOFT", "DRIVER_MEDIA", "DRIVER_ERROR",
"DRIVER_INVALID", "DRIVER_TIMEOUT", "DRIVER_HARD", "DRIVER_SENSE"};
-#define NUM_DRIVERBYTE_STRS ARRAY_SIZE(driverbyte_table)
-void scsi_show_result(int result)
+#endif
+
+const char *scsi_hostbyte_string(int result)
{
+ const char *hb_string = NULL;
+#ifdef CONFIG_SCSI_CONSTANTS
int hb = host_byte(result);
- int db = driver_byte(result);
- printk("Result: hostbyte=%s driverbyte=%s\n",
- (hb < NUM_HOSTBYTE_STRS ? hostbyte_table[hb] : "invalid"),
- (db < NUM_DRIVERBYTE_STRS ? driverbyte_table[db] : "invalid"));
+ if (hb < ARRAY_SIZE(hostbyte_table))
+ hb_string = hostbyte_table[hb];
+#endif
+ return hb_string;
}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(scsi_hostbyte_string);
-#else
+const char *scsi_driverbyte_string(int result)
+{
+ const char *db_string = NULL;
+#ifdef CONFIG_SCSI_CONSTANTS
+ int db = driver_byte(result);
+
+ if (db < ARRAY_SIZE(driverbyte_table))
+ db_string = driverbyte_table[db];
+#endif
+ return db_string;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(scsi_driverbyte_string);
void scsi_show_result(int result)
{
- printk("Result: hostbyte=0x%02x driverbyte=0x%02x\n",
- host_byte(result), driver_byte(result));
-}
+ const char *hb_string = scsi_hostbyte_string(result);
+ const char *db_string = scsi_driverbyte_string(result);
-#endif
+ if (hb_string || db_string)
+ printk("Result: hostbyte=%s driverbyte=%s\n",
+ hb_string ? hb_string : "invalid",
+ db_string ? db_string : "invalid");
+ else
+ printk("Result: hostbyte=0x%02x driverbyte=0x%02x\n",
+ host_byte(result), driver_byte(result));
+}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(scsi_show_result);
void scsi_print_result(struct scsi_cmnd *cmd)
{
- scmd_printk(KERN_INFO, cmd, " ");
- scsi_show_result(cmd->result);
+ const char *hb_string = scsi_hostbyte_string(cmd->result);
+ const char *db_string = scsi_driverbyte_string(cmd->result);
+
+ if (hb_string || db_string)
+ scmd_printk(KERN_INFO, cmd,
+ "Result: hostbyte=%s driverbyte=%s",
+ hb_string ? hb_string : "invalid",
+ db_string ? db_string : "invalid");
+ else
+ scmd_printk(KERN_INFO, cmd,
+ "Result: hostbyte=0x%02x driverbyte=0x%02x",
+ host_byte(cmd->result), driver_byte(cmd->result));
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(scsi_print_result);
diff --git a/include/scsi/scsi_dbg.h b/include/scsi/scsi_dbg.h
index 81d0418..50f4d85 100644
--- a/include/scsi/scsi_dbg.h
+++ b/include/scsi/scsi_dbg.h
@@ -19,6 +19,8 @@ extern void __scsi_print_sense(const struct scsi_device *, const char *name,
int sense_len);
extern void scsi_show_result(int);
extern void scsi_print_result(struct scsi_cmnd *);
+extern const char *scsi_hostbyte_string(int);
+extern const char *scsi_driverbyte_string(int);
extern const char *scsi_sense_key_string(unsigned char);
extern const char *scsi_extd_sense_format(unsigned char, unsigned char,
const char **);
--
1.8.5.2
